About Uranquinty

Uranquinty is a small town located approximately 15 kilometres south of Wagga Wagga in the Riverina region of New South Wales, within the City of Wagga Wagga local government area. With a population of around 910 residents, the town — affectionately known locally as 'Quinty' — sits in the rolling pastoral country of southern New South Wales, some 391 kilometres south-west of Sydney. The town has a proud history connected to the construction of the Wagga Wagga to Albury railway line, when Uranquinty served as a key railway village for workers building the line.

Uranquinty is home to one of Australia's long-running folk festivals, held annually on the October long weekend, which draws visitors from across the region and beyond. The town retains a genuine country character with its historic hotel, agricultural surroundings, and tight-knit community. Day-to-day amenities are accessed in nearby Wagga Wagga, which offers a full range of services, hospitals, shopping centres, and the regional Charles Sturt University campus. For those seeking a quiet rural lifestyle within easy reach of a major regional centre, Uranquinty offers an affordable and community-oriented alternative.

Uranquinty falls under postcode 2652 and is governed by the Wagga Wagga Council (Local Government Area). For federal elections, residents vote in the electorate of Riverina, while state elections fall under the Wagga Wagga electorate.

🏷️ Property Prices 2025

Median sale prices in Uranquinty for 2025. Based on every residential settlement recorded by the NSW Valuer General in 2025.

🏡House
$570K
22 sales · ▲ 4.1% vs 2024

Source: NSW Valuer General — Property Sales Information. Strata-titled sales are counted as units; all others as houses. Suburbs with fewer than 5 sales in a category are omitted.

💰 Income

ATO taxable income Postcode 2652

Median taxable income for individual taxpayers in postcode 2652 for the 2023–24 financial year (2019–20 data not published for this postcode).

Median 2019–20
N/A
Median 2023–24
$58,414
Average taxable income (2023–24)
$65,570

Source: ATO Taxation Statistics 2023–24, Individuals Table 8 (median & average taxable income by postcode). Covers all individuals who lodged a return in postcode 2652; postcodes with fewer than 200 lodgments are suppressed by the ATO.

🚔 Crime Statistics LGA-wide

These are the latest 2025 rates for the Wagga Wagga Local Government Area, which contains Uranquinty. Rates are per 100,000 residents; trends compare 2 and 10 year periods ending Dec 2025.

Break & enter (dwelling)
533.7 / 100k
Motor vehicle theft
239.3 / 100k
Non-DV assault
645.4 / 100k
Robbery (unarmed)
10.2 / 100k
Steal from vehicle
559.8 / 100k

Source: NSW Bureau of Crime Statistics and Research (BOCSAR)
